Hitozuma Elf no Orusuban was developed by a Japanese amateur group known as (ミルクフォース) . They are primarily known for creating simple, engaging RPGs using the RPG Maker engine, with a focus on high-quality artwork and charming, often romantic, narratives. Their other known title, Princess Go Round , a game released in 2018, features similar elements: excellent artwork and a cute, predictable story .
